Inspect callable tools, capabilities, and parameters exposed to AI agents by Authoryze.
request_purchaseAsk to make a purchase from a specific merchant, for a specific amount, with a reason. The request either gets approved automatically, gets sent to the account owner for approval, gets denied with a reason, or fails in a way that's safe to retry.
check_statusLook up what happened to a purchase request: approved, denied, still waiting on approval, or failed. Doesn't reveal any card details itself.
get_spending_summarySee how much has been spent so far against the configured limits (daily, weekly, monthly, and total), including any account-wide limit that applies across all of an account's agents.
retrieve_cardOnce a purchase is approved, get the actual card number, expiry, and security code to complete the purchase. This can only be done once per approved purchase; the details are shown a single time and can't be retrieved again.
Authoryze gives your AI agent a spending limit. It lets you hand an agent a payment method without handing it your card: you define what it can buy, from which merchants, and up to what amount, and every purchase request comes to you for approval before a single-use virtual card is issued. It is built on Visa Intelligent Commerce and Mastercard Agent Pay, and is currently available for US-issued cards. Authoryze is a remote MCP (Model Context Protocol) server that works with Claude, Claude Code, ChatGPT, Cursor, Windsurf, and any MCP-compatible client.
OAuth-capable clients such as Claude and ChatGPT need only the endpoint:
Clients that don't support OAuth, such as Claude Code, Codex, and custom frameworks, authenticate with a static agent API key as a bearer token:
Authoryze is available for US-issued cards only. International support is pending issuer coverage on the agentic token programs.
Authentication requires either OAuth 2.1 with PKCE (S256) and Dynamic Client Registration, or a static agent API key used as a bearer token.
